Sen. Mike Lee explains his votes opposing promotions for 2 generals

Summary by Ground News
Sen. Tommy Tuberville, R-Ala., has been blocking military nominations over his opposition to a Pentagon policy which funds service members to travel to receive abortions. Tuerville told Republican colleagues Tuesday he would back a vote for Gen. Eric Smith to be confirmed as commandant for the Marine Corps. Smith was confirmed Thursday in a 96-0 vote. Utah Sen. Mike Lee was the lone vote in opposition. Lee also opposed the confirmation of Gen. Charles Q. Brown as chairman of the Joint Chiefs of Staff, who was confirmed Wednesday in an 83-11 vote.
